Episode 3: Things I Wish I Would Have Known Before Surgery
In this episode, Dawn shares the things she wishes someone had told her before bladder removal surgery. Not the pamphlet version. The real life version.
From recovery timelines and emotional surprises to stoma placement, weight restrictions, supplies, wardrobe changes, and the mental toll no one prepares you for, this episode walks through what urostomy life actually looks like in the weeks and months after surgery. Dawn talks honestly about complications, fatigue, grief, adaptation, and learning to trust your body again, all with humor and heart.
Whether you are preparing for surgery, newly living with a urostomy, supporting someone you love, or simply trying to understand what life after bladder removal involves, this episode offers practical insight, reassurance, and lived experience from someone who has walked it.
This is not about fear. It is about information, patience, resilience, and knowing you are not alone as you find your new normal.
